Well I got to sling about 20 arrows today with the 350 and 340. Its a nice bow, but not what I was expecting. The handle seems to slim for my likings. I do like the laminated limb design and It does have a smooth draw but the hand shock was nothing special. All in all nothing really stood out and made me say wow. For the price I'll stick to my allegience and admiral. IMO the admiral is the way to go. I got to talking to the bow guru and he felt the same way I did. Said he put his admiral up and took the Destroyer home and said after about a week of shooting it he pulled his admiral back out and sold the destroyer.
To each his own, but i feel with all the hype that bowtech made about the destroyer it was a let down for me.
